Xiaoguang Chen
Cisco · Institute Of Materia Medica, Chinese Academy Of Medical Sciences · Sichuan Jiuzhang Biological Science And Technology Co.
Total Patents:
36
Overall Rank:
#91,292
Years Active:
1994–2025
Cisco Rank:
#1,257